M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
analyzes
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
learning technology have provided the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
MOOC classes are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
subjects that
learning technology organizations
are struggling with
now that e-learning technology is
improving so quickly.
How can participants
be assured that
the quality of schooling provided by these
MOOC classes is
tolerable?
How can organizations
be assured that
teachers are properly credentialed
to teach classes online?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
Australia to conduct these MOOC classes?
What teaching practices and assessment strategies are optimal?
How can we
deal with
inadequate
student motivation and high
student attrition?
